Can you switch at mobile phone to Verizon?

When considering switching over to another carrier from Verizon, note that: All 4G LTE Verizon phones come network unlocked. You should be able to use your 4G device on AT&T and T-Mobile. Some Verizon phones—newer iPhones, Google Nexus models, and some Motorola handsets—will work with Sprint.

Do Verizon phones come unlocked?

Most Verizon 4G LTE phones are on postpay plans, and those phones come unlocked by default. But if your phone is from a Verizon prepaid plan or an iPhone 3G World Device, you'll need to unlock your new phone.

What happens if you take out your SIM card and put it in another phone?

You can take the SIM card out, put it into another phone, and if someone calls your number, the new phone will ring. If the SIM card and phone serial number don't match, the phone simply won't work. The SIM card won't work in other phones, and the phone won't work with other SIM cards.

Is Verizon shutting down CDMA?

Indeed, in 2012, a Verizon executive initially hinted that Verizon would shutter its 2G and 3G CDMA networks by 2021, but then in 2016 Verizon confirmed to FierceWireless that it would shut down its CDMA network by Dec. 31, 2019.

Are Verizon phones unlocked 2019?

In July of 2019, Verizon changed its previous policy of selling most phones unlocked to one where devices come unlocked for at least 60 days after purchase. Once you've had your Verizon phone for at least 60 days, Verizon will automatically unlock your phone and you'll be able to take it to another carrier.

Is my phone GSM or CDMA?

Check your phone's "About" settings.
If you see an MEID or an ESN category, your phone requires CDMA; if you see an IMEI category, your phone is GSM. If you see both (e.g., Verizon phones), your phone supports both CDMA and GSM, and may be either one.
